Considering a Career in Real Estate Appraising?
Real estate is a cornerstone of our economy, and every property that is bought, sold, financed, insured, developed, or taxed depends on a credible appraisal. Accurate valuations provide the foundation for informed decisions and help ensure successful real estate transactions.
Real estate appraisers are skilled problem solvers who analyze market data, property characteristics, and economic trends to develop well-supported opinions of value. Their work is essential to property owners, lenders, investors, government agencies, and other stakeholders who rely on objective and independent valuations.
A career in real estate appraisal offers flexibility, variety, and unlimited opportunities. Appraisers can specialize in residential, commercial, industrial, agricultural, or other property types, working locally or throughout the country. With a constant demand for reliable property valuations, appraisal remains a dynamic and rewarding profession with excellent long-term career potential.
